如何实现Go语言中字符串到整数的类型转换函数?

2026-04-01 22:170阅读0评论SEO基础
  • 内容介绍
  • 文章标签
  • 相关推荐

本文共计565个文字,预计阅读时间需要3分钟。

如何实现Go语言中字符串到整数的类型转换函数?

学习Go语言中的类型转换函数并实现字符串转整数的功能。在Go语言中,类型转换是将一个数据类型转换为另一个数据类型的过程。Go语言提供了类型转换函数来实现不同类型之间的转换。以下是一个实现字符串转整数的示例代码:

gopackage main

import (fmtstrconv)

func main() {str :=123intVal, err :=strconv.Atoi(str)if err !=nil {fmt.Println(转换错误:, err)} else {fmt.Println(转换结果:, intVal)}}

学习Go语言中的类型转换函数并实现字符串转整数的功能

在Go语言中,类型转换是将一个数据类型转换为另一个数据类型的过程。Go语言提供了类型转换函数来实现不同类型之间的转换。

本文将通过学习Go中的类型转换函数,以及示例代码实现字符串转整数的功能。

  1. 使用strconv包的Atoi()函数进行字符串到整数的转换

Go语言的strconv包提供了许多用于类型转换的函数。其中,Atoi()函数用于将字符串转换为整数。下面是Atoi()函数的声明及用法示例:

func Atoi(s string) (int, error)

Atoi()函数的参数是一个字符串s,返回值是转换后的整数和一个错误。如果转换成功,返回转换后的整数值和nil;如果转换失败,返回0和一个错误。

阅读全文

本文共计565个文字,预计阅读时间需要3分钟。

如何实现Go语言中字符串到整数的类型转换函数?

学习Go语言中的类型转换函数并实现字符串转整数的功能。在Go语言中,类型转换是将一个数据类型转换为另一个数据类型的过程。Go语言提供了类型转换函数来实现不同类型之间的转换。以下是一个实现字符串转整数的示例代码:

gopackage main

import (fmtstrconv)

func main() {str :=123intVal, err :=strconv.Atoi(str)if err !=nil {fmt.Println(转换错误:, err)} else {fmt.Println(转换结果:, intVal)}}

学习Go语言中的类型转换函数并实现字符串转整数的功能

在Go语言中,类型转换是将一个数据类型转换为另一个数据类型的过程。Go语言提供了类型转换函数来实现不同类型之间的转换。

本文将通过学习Go中的类型转换函数,以及示例代码实现字符串转整数的功能。

  1. 使用strconv包的Atoi()函数进行字符串到整数的转换

Go语言的strconv包提供了许多用于类型转换的函数。其中,Atoi()函数用于将字符串转换为整数。下面是Atoi()函数的声明及用法示例:

func Atoi(s string) (int, error)

Atoi()函数的参数是一个字符串s,返回值是转换后的整数和一个错误。如果转换成功,返回转换后的整数值和nil;如果转换失败,返回0和一个错误。

阅读全文